About the Tests
- In 2008-2009 Wyoming administered the Proficiency Assessments for Wyoming Students (PAWS) in reading, writing and math to
students in grades 3 through 8 and 11, and in science in grades 4, 8 and 11.
- PAWS tests are standards-based, which means they measure how well students are mastering specific skills defined for each
grade by the state of Wyoming.
- The goal is for all students score at or above the proficient level.
